Burp Armor

Burp Armor is one of my favorite new must-haves for parents. Even my husband, who is not easy to impress, had nothing but good things to say about the burp cloth that came in the mail...perhaps due to the fact that it is designed by a fellow dad and he saw the practicality of it.

Burp Armor is made in the United States from 45% organic cotton and 55% sustainable hemp. Your order arrives in recyclable packaging pre-washed in organic soap making them super soft and ready for use. And all inks used are soy-based making these the most eco-friendly burp cloth possible.

The icing on the cake is that they also look fantastic, the shape makes them stay put on your shoulder, and they are extra-thick as they're composed of three layers...true armor for your shoulder. I can almost not wait for my newborn to spit up on me in two months. Almost.

Don't be surprised if your Burp Armor quickly becomes a soft, cuddly lovie...it's been known to happen. They're a great size for toddlers to carry around, and the feeling of the fleece next to their face may be comforting as they recall being close to you as they grew.

Funkie Baby

Funkie Baby makes bibs, burp cloths (Burpies) and little mats that can be used for infant tummy time or as a changing mat (Go Mats). I'm in love with their modern yet vintage fabric designs. The examples shown here are only a few of their timeless looks.

Each of their three items are made using a triple layer technique with the front and the back being cotton, but the middle being a soft, soak-proof lining. And all are machine washable!

The Bibs are very generously sized keeping your child clean and dry. They're soft and great for wearing during those drooling, teething days...the triple layers keep your baby nice and dry! The Burpies are also large enough to keep your shoulder clean and soft enough to keep your baby comfortable.

And the Go Mats, I can't tell you enough how much I love these! They fold up quite small (even with the triple layer design) and are perfect for stashing in your bag for either your mom's club meeting where you can let baby out of their car seat and put them safely on to a clean surface for some tummy time. Or you can keep one in the car for unexpected diaper changes.
